The Tanaiste is describing Irish peacekeepers being fired at in Lebanon as "reckless" and "intimidatory action" by Israel.
The Defence Forces said several small arms rounds were fired near a joint patrol with the Lebanese Armed Forces close to the Blue Line.
No injuries were reported, and the patrol safely withdrew from the area.
